Daniel Tue, 24 June 2025
Poor
Liked: Room would have been nice if not for the scaffolding and work men literally outside the window - they could see in and made my wife feel awkward getting ready.
Disliked: They didn’t tell us work was going on. Woke up early with men working. The lounge staff weren’t refilling the canapé parts. It’s not really acceptable to charge £200 plus for a room with no privacy unless you shut the curtains. It would have been a really nice hotel but they need to be making guests aware of the conditions especially saying that men will be working within feet of your window and can see in. It was my wife and her mam staying in the room. No tea but room had coffee. Minibar was empty. Photo attached - we would have booked a different hotel had we known.

Amy Fri, 20 June 2025
Ideal location for exploring the...
Liked: Location was ideal for exploring Edinburgh. The room was very large but I didn't have a very good view. There were obviously very old wood floors under the carpet because they would squeak when I walked. The bathroom was great. Large walk-in shower, very hot water with good spray power. The restaurant had a small bar section which was ideal for relaxing after a long day exploring.
Disliked: Hotel is on the High Street which requires walking up 104 stairs up from the train station. Or you walk around the "block" which is about a mile. Suggest taking a taxi if towing luggage from the train station. Hotel had an elevator that accessed the Market Street Train Station level (-4) but couldn't access it going back up to the hotel. Staff said the reader didn't work...and they never answered the intercom.... Had to walk another mile just to get up to the High Street level.
